The Special Prosecutor, has filed charges in absence against three Serbs with initials L.A., P.B. and M.I., under war crimes allegations in Pristina prison and Lipjan.
The Special Prosecutor reports that “defendant L.A., in terms of the official person of the District Prison in Pristina, during the period of armed conflict, the 1998-1999 war in Kosovo, in Pristina Prison and in the parallel in Lipjan, in association with other prison officials, in co-ordination has carried out the criminal work, with the Civil People's Anti-Plumb” respectively.
Meanwhile, defendants P.B. and M.I., in the quality of official-guarded persons of Pristina Prison and parallels in Lipjan, during the period of armed conflict, the 1998-1999 war in Kosovo, in Pristina Prison and in the parallel in Lipjan, in association with other prison officials, in co-ordination have carried out the criminal work of the Civil People's War.
